<p>With midterms getting closer and closer a movie is a good way to relieve any stress and to just relax and take a break from all that cramming and studying.</p>
<p>On Friday January 13 three new movies will be opening in wide release: Beauty and the Beast in 3D, Contraband, and Joyful Noise.</p>
<p>Beauty and the Beast is a timeless Disney classic. It tells the story of Belle, a girl who goes to live in a mansion with a Beast and how she falls in love with him. Originally released in 1991 the movie has been remade and is now available in 3D.</p>
<p>Contraband is an action/adventure and thriller film. Former smuggler Chris Farraday, played by Mark Wahlberg, is forced back into the business after his brother-in-law botches a deal. In order to set things right Chris must smuggle millions of dollars in counterfeit bills from Panama into the United States. And if anything goes wrong the drug lords will target his entire family for death. The film stars Mark Wahlberg, Kate Beckinsale, Ben Foster, and Giovanni Ribisi.</p>
<p>Joyful Noise is a musical/performing arts film starring Queen Latifa, Dolly Parton, and Keke Palmer. The movie is about the church choir of a small Georgia town. The choir has entered a national competition but the two leading women, Vi Rose (Queen Latifa) and G.G. (Dolly Parton) are disagreeing about everything. The two must pull it together and work things out for the sake of the choir or they could lose everything.</p>

<p>Following a poor, sixth place finish in the Iowa Caucus, Republican Presidential candidate Michelle Bachmann removed herself from the race this morning.  Despite being from Iowa and having been the in first place in August straw polls, Bachmann was not able to capitalize on such potential opportunities.</p>
<p>CHS students following the race are not particularly shocked by this development.</p>
<p>&#8220;I saw how her campaign was unfolding and I think it was the right decision for her to drop out,&#8221; Junior Will Seitz said.  &#8221;She didn&#8217;t have a very legitimate shot, so there&#8217;s no real point in continuing.&#8221;</p>
<p>After losing momentum over the past few months, Bachmann&#8217;s legitimacy as a candidate was, frankly, almost nonexistent.</p>
<p>Meanwhile, Mitt Romney, the surging Rick Santorum, Ron Paul, Newt Gingrich, and Rick Perry finished first through fifth, respectively.  These candidates will fight to the finish for the trust of Republican Americans.</p>

<p>This article will not make Jon Huntsman win the Republican Nomination. In all honesty, it probably won’t even help. And that’s a shame.</p>
<p>Before I begin, I want to get one thing straight: I have been a supporter of Barack Obama since he first started his presidential campaign. I have been behind Obama since I first saw his 2004 Democratic National Convention speech and heard him remind me that “there is not a liberal America and a conservative America – there is the United States of America.”</p>
<p>What attracted me to Obama was his message of “hope” and “change.” Not only was he eloquent and exciting, but he was telling it like it is. Many people thought he was too inexperienced and that his name was too different and his skin too dark, but he was different and I believed he would do things differently. I was wrong.</p>
<p>Jon Stewart put it best when he said “I have been saddened to see that someone who ran on the idea that you can&#8217;t expect to get different results with the same people and the same system has kept in place so much of the same system and same people.&#8221;</p>
<p>Before I am a democrat, a republican or a moderate, I am an American. I want this country to work. I hoped Obama would change the system he preached against through his years of campaigning. He&#8217;s hasn’t. Therefore, he&#8217;s not the best choice to be President of the United States.</p>
<p>Now, that doesn’t mean that Obama is the worst choice either. It doesn’t mean he can’t succeed. I will vote for Barack Obama… unless his opponent is Jon Huntsman. Mitt Romney, Newt Gingrich, Herman Cain, Ron Paul, Rick Perry and Michele Bachmann have done nothing that leads me to believe they would be better presidents than Obama. Huntsman has.</p>
<p>Huntsman stands out for the simple reason that he doesn’t try to stand out. As Anthony Bergen wrote, “Romney flip-flops, Gingrich is kind of a creep, Ron Paul is out-of-touch an unrealistic, Bachmann and Santorum are religious nuts, Herman Cain is a clown, and Rick Perry is a joke.”</p>
<p>Huntsman is reasonable. We need reasonable leaders. This country was formed by reasonable men in an era that was actually called “the Age of Reason.” While the founding fathers may not have gotten everything right, every decision they made was supported by thought and reason. Jon Huntsman is a man of reason.</p>
<p>While voters flitch at the idea of calling anyone a moderate, moderation is exactly what the United States needs. Moderation doesn’t erase core beliefs. I’m not going to change mine and I don’t want my president to change theirs. Huntsman is a worldly and sane leader.</p>
<p>Huntsman is for civil unions for same sex couples, but against same sex marriage. That’s not what my perfect president would believe, but it was Obama&#8217;s stance in 2008 and I’m willing to compromise. Huntsman is pro-life and against abortions in the second and third trimesters. I respect his prolife stance (I disagree with it, but I respect it.) As for evolution and climate change, this is what Huntsman tweeted in August: “To be clear. I believe in evolution and trust scientists on global warming. Call me crazy.”</p>
<p>Will Jon Huntsman win? I hope so. Can he win? Absolutely. He is the most formidable opponent to take on President Obama and he is the most appealing GOP candidate. It will be difficult for him to clinch republican support, but I believe the he would have a shot at the presidency. Huntsman has a platform that manages to appeal to youth, democrats and minorities. All other candidates are running for the GOP nomination. Huntsman is running for the President of the United States.</p>

<p>As the school year strikes with full force for the students at Coppell High School, the class of 2012 prepares to take its throne with class.</p>
<p>Webster’s defines seniority as “priority, precedence, or status obtained as the result of a person&#8217;s length of service,” and as a high school senior, this definition can have quite a few different interpretations.</p>
<p>“Seniority definitely deals some aspects of carelessness, but you feel more mature and know how to handle your work-load and can balance work and play,” said senior Chris Reagan, sports director of KCBY.</p>
<p>While some seniors focus on the power and maturity that comes with senior year, others are taking advantage of the freedoms that come with it.</p>
<p>“[Being a senior is] an inordinate gift of confidence,” senior Class President Anna Nudo said. “We feel fine walking down the hallways, singing to the songs over the loud speaker, not caring what any underclassmen think.”</p>
<p>Senior perks affect the majority of the class. Options including dual credit and senior release give students the opportunity to get out of certain periods everyday making their schedules less hectic.</p>
<p>Contrary to that, students like Nudo work hard and take on the responsibilities of planning fundraisers and events for the senior class, to ensure a smooth year.</p>
<p>“Our main goal this year is to raise as much money as possible to make prom tickets as cheap as possible, “ Nudo said. “We have had a couple fundraisers like the parking spot painting, homecoming parade and also a T-Shirt sale.”</p>
<p>The perks of senior year have enabled students to show more school spirit through senior overalls and jorts, as well as having benefits in the classroom.</p>
<p>“I think the teachers are more lenient in class about not giving us a lot of work and the CHS traditions like senior overalls are a big hit among the girls,” senior offensive lineman Jake Williams said.</p>
<p>Senior plunger boy Teddy Croft gets the student section pumped up every game, showing his pride for CHS with rowdy chants and plunger thrusts.</p>
<p>“Being a senior means I get to act as crazy and loud as I want at games and don’t have the feeling of being humiliated in front of my peers,” Croft said.</p>
<p>The culmination of high school has also given the students a sense of appreciation for the hard work and sacrifices made by the faculty, parents and volunteers who make CHS such a success.</p>
<p>“CHS has done so much for us and it’s our chance to show how much we appreciate our school,” Croft said.</p>
<div id="attachment_22452" class="wp-caption alignleft" style="width: 310px"><a href="http://www.coppellstudentm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/09/DSC_0640.jpg"><img class="size-medium wp-image-22452" title="" src="http://www.coppellstudentm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/09/DSC_0640-300x200.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="200"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">Photo by Rowan Khazendar.</p></div>
<p>CHS provides unprecedented opportunities that no other school can, and now even more with the addition of the academy, that focus on different areas of talent and give students an idea of what career that want to pursue in the future.</p>
<p>Reagan, a three-year veteran to the KCBY staff, describes his experiences at CHS as “life changing.”</p>
<p>“We have a lot of opportunities at CHS and with the KCBY program I really fell in love with a career I could see myself in down the road,” Reagan said.</p>
<p>Entering CHS as a freshman, you are subjected to a completely different setting and lifestyle. The intimidations of keeping up with homework and balancing a social life can run its toll on a lot of students. You may even envision high school as a four-year prison sentence, but this year’s seniors are more assuring.</p>
<p>“It’s all worth it in the end,” Williams said. “Just make sure to try your hardest freshman and junior year and stay focused on academics.”</p>

<p>According to Harold Camping, the rapture may not be that far away.</p>
<p>That’s right – the Armageddon that Family Radio Worldwide’s leader Harold Camping predicted is happening this Saturday.</p>
<p>For those who somehow missed the news reports of Camping’s band of RVs that help to spread the word of the end, or the billboards that announce the date, Camping and his followers believe that the end of times will be on May 21 2011, rather than the 2012 date that most people believe. Of course, there are plenty of people who are <a href="http://www.huffingtonpost.com/2011/05/11/21-reasons-may-21-not-end-of-world_n_860747.html#s277570&amp;title=21_Our_Milk">skeptical</a> of his claims, especially when you consider that Camping has <a href="http://www.orlandosentinel.com/features/os-judgment-day-camping-20110519,0,7614935.story">predicted the apocalypse before</a> and failed (afterward, he admitted that he did not do enough biblical study).</p>
<p>Maybe the world will end this Saturday, maybe not. Whatever the answer, we will find out soon enough.</p>
